Napoli Takes Steps Forward in Resolving Di Lorenzo Dilemma Through Crisis Meeting

A breakthrough was made during a crisis meeting between Napoli officials and Di Lorenzo’s agent, with Di Lorenzo expressing his desire to stay at the club this summer. The meeting took place at two different hotels in Naples, with Coach Conte, President De Laurentiis, new director of sport Giovanni Manna, club manager Antonio Sinicropi, and chief revenue officer Tommaso Bianchini in attendance. Di Lorenzo’s agent, Mario Giuffredi, was staying at the Hotel Britannique next door.

According to Sky Sport Italia, the initial impressions from the meeting were positive, with Napoli assuring that they would address whatever off-field situation had caused Di Lorenzo’s desire to leave. Despite his push to join Juventus, Napoli continues to insist that Di Lorenzo is not for sale.

In a surprising turn of events, Giuffredi agreed to extend Italy international Michael Folorunsho’s contract with Napoli until June 2027. This step, along with the progress made in the crisis meeting, signals a potential resolution to the Di Lorenzo situation at Napoli.
